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2017 was CNY 23,819.57 million, representing a year-on-year increase of 7.93% compared to CNY 22,070.41 million in 2016[19]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company reached CNY 1,545.88 million, a significant increase of 318.85% from a loss of CNY 74.49 million in the previous year[19]. - The basic earnings per share for 2017 was CNY 0.6601, reflecting a 200.05% increase from CNY -0.1254 in 2016[19]. - The total assets of the company at the end of 2017 amounted to CNY 39,613.92 million, an increase of 8.55% from CNY 36,492.51 million at the end of 2016[19]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ders of the listed company were CNY 18,778.01 million, up 11.00% from CNY 16,917.79 million in 2016[19]. - The company reported a net cash flow from operating activities of CNY 3,958.39 million, which is a decrease of 6.58% compared to CNY 4,237.15 million in the previous year[19]. - The company achieved a steady revenue growth due to an increasingly differentiated product portfolio, despite a declining agricultural market overall[44]. - The company reported a year-on-year increase in net profit, driven by robust sales volume growth and a continuous shift towards a differentiated product mix[44]. - The effective tax rate decreased due to the generation of deferred tax assets, while tax expenses increased in line with higher pre-tax profits[45]. - The company’s gross profit margin improved to 35.33%, up from 32.22% in 2016, indicating better cost management[50]. Mergers and Acquisitions - The company has undergone a significant asset restructuring, acquiring 100% equity of Adama Solutions through the issuance of 1,810,883,039 A shares[10]. - The company completed the merger with Adama Solutions on July 4, 2017, which will enhance its global market presence and operational capabilities[29]. - Following the merger, the company raised approximately 1.5 billion yuan for further product development and expansion of advanced operational facilities[30]. - The company completed the acquisition of 100% equity in ADAMA Solutions in 2017, which was incorporated into the consolidated financial statements[168]. - The company is undergoing a merger with Andermatt, which is expected to enhance its overall business development[149]. Market Position and Strategy - The company operates in over 100 countries, focusing on non-patented crop protection products, including herbicides, fungicides, and insecticides[31]. - The company holds a significant position in the global crop protection market, ranking 6th in terms of sales[28]. - The company plans to enhance its market position through a differentiated product portfolio, focusing on high-value, innovative solutions[101]. - The company aims to connect China with global markets, leveraging the potential of China's fragmented agricultural market, which is expected to become the largest crop protection market[102]. - The company is focusing on developing unique formulations and products to address challenges such as pest resistance and crop protection[101]. - The competitive landscape in the crop protection industry remains fragmented, with numerous local producers competing against multinational companies[96]. Research and Development - Research and development investment increased by 59.58% to 360,403 thousand yuan, representing 1.51% of total revenue, up from 1.02% in 2016[60]. - The company has established research and development centers in Israel, India, Brazil, and China, focusing on the development of non-patented products and compliance with global regulatory requirements[58]. - The company obtained around 1,300 new registration certificates in the past five years, enhancing its ability to introduce new products efficiently in key markets[39]. Risks and Challenges - The company faces significant risks in emerging markets, including political instability, currency volatility, and economic conditions, which could negatively impact sales and collection performance[119]. - The crop protection market is highly competitive, with the top five R&D companies holding 60% of the global market share, posing a threat to Adama Solutions' market position[120]. - The company is experiencing increased competition from non-patent companies and small R&D firms, which may negatively affect sales volume and pricing strategies[121]. - Agricultural activity may be adversely affected by extreme weather conditions and natural disasters, leading to reduced demand for the company's products[123]. - The company is subject to strict environmental, health, and safety regulations, which may require significant financial and human resources to comply with, potentially affecting profitability[125].
